On Thursday, August 6, we held our annual Education Week Assembly.
While we were unable to celebrate this with parents, we still acknowledged our hard-working students.
Two students from each class were recognised for their commitment to learning and citizenship.
Our school leaders received a special Education Week Leadership Award which was presented by Mrs Frampton on behalf of our director, Ms Toni McDonald.
We also acknowledged our stage citizens.
These awards are usually presented by our mayor on behalf of Oberon Council.
All of these awards recognise outstanding commitment and citizenship.
